This Peruvian Lily is a free-flowering perennial with dense, green foliage and gorgeous, ongoing colors that seamlessly blend with the tones of Summer and Fall months. The long-lasting sunset-hued blooms are embellished with a yellow throat and deep red whiskers that perfectly flatter her green, lance-shaped leaves.

Alstroemeria Colorita® 'Amina' is an excellent border plant and also well suited for containers and small gardens. Grow her in a partial sunny spot with fertile, evenly moist, well-draining soil and you won't be sorry you did! Be careful, dry soil induces dormancy and reduces flowering vigor. Deadhead spent flowers as needed or bring flowers inside to take advantage of their long vase life as cut flowers. In early Spring, trim back or gently pull out old tuberous stems to encourage new growth and better flowering.

Are you lucky enough to have A/C? Do you keep your home temperate year-round? These compact Alstroemeria may be the most spectacular houseplant for you! As long as nobody has allergies to pollen of course.

Alstroemeria are true Goldilocks plants, they don't like it too hot nor too cold. They are native to the Andes mountain region of South America, where it stays cool/temperate year-round. Ideal temperatures are 50-65F but they can withstand intermittent hot days up to 75 F with afternoon shade and a little TLC. Frost will kill unprotected leaves and roots.


Easy to Grow Features

  • Zones: 8 - 10; Annual everywhere else; Mulch or bring potted plants inside below 40F. Can be perennial to zone 7 with extra protection
  • Light: Partial Sun; Bright indirect or filtered light is best
  • Water: Moderate
  • Height: 10 - 14 inches when flowering
  • Bloom Color: Deep Orange Flowers with Yellow Throats
  • Bloom Season: Late Spring - Early Fall
